Transaction ed6f24c043227a537c013cfd9a93fab884f6af923a6e2893b8402d7c1d92cf62
1 Input
1 Output
-
ed6f24c043227a537c013cfd9a93fab884f6af923a6e2893b8402d7c1d92cf62:0
- value
- 82380
- script pubkey
- OP_0 OP_PUSHBYTES_20 57237a2a070f542229e20d2a934716731f24812b
- address
- bc1q2u3h52s8pa2zy20zp54fx3ckwv0jfqftq85nen